freebsd-ports/x11-toolkits/tk80/pkg-install.wish
Tim Vanderhoek 8a135bbda0 Install a wish script that spits-out all the various names for wish. The
script handles for tclX and tkstep.  This is as per several discussions
on -ports.  I expect one or two of the depending ports to break silently.

I didn't touch the ja-ports, since INSTALL.wish might want translating?

PR:		bin/5894
Mention:	Eivind, who wrote part of INSTALL.wish

#!/bin/sh
# The user may have a wish they want to preserve
if [ ! -f 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ish ] || [ \
`grep -a awieYJFnsuILOnfsYEW 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ish | sed -e 's/.*\*\*//'` \
-lt 001 ]
then
[ -f 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ish ] && chmod u+w 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ish
cat > 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ish <<'EOF'
#!/bin/sh
# Installed by ports system. id: awieYJFnsuILOnfsYEW**001
(
echo "In FreeBSD, wish is named with a version number. This is because"
echo "different versions of wish are not compatible with each other and"
echo "they can not all be called \"wish\"! You may need multiple versions"
echo "installed because a given port may depend on a specific version."
echo
echo "On your system, wish is installed under at least the following names:"
echo
for name in $(/bin/ls $(echo $PATH | sed 's/:/ /g') 2> /dev/null | egrep '^wish(step)?(x|([0-9]+\.[0-9]+))([a-z][a-z])?$')
do
echo $name
done
[ "$name" = "" ] && echo "No wish installations found, sorry."
) 1>&2
exit 1
EOF
chmod a+rx ${PKG_PREFIX}/bin/wish
fi
